Absa Bank has recently undergone a significant rebranding effort, transitioning from its previous slogan “Africanacity” to a new brand promise of “Your Story Matters.” This shift is part of a strategic move to deepen the bank’s engagement with its customers and reflect a more empathetic approach to its services.
The Managing Director of Absa Bank Botswana, Keabetswe Pheko-Moshagane, unveiled this new branding, emphasizing the importance of empathy as the driving force behind the bank’s renewed purpose. The change in branding aligns with Absa’s updated corporate mission of “Empowering Africa’s Tomorrow, Together,… One Story at a Time,” indicating a shift towards a more narrative-driven, empathetic customer engagement strategy.
Pheko-Moshagane explained that the rebranding is a reflection of Absa’s commitment to understanding and addressing the real-life situations and challenges faced by its customers on a daily basis.
